摘要
The objective of this text is to understand and explain what are the perspectives, tensions, and contributions of digital culture to the training of teachers of the curricular component of Physical Education (P.E.). The applied methodology consisted of the application of questionnaires through online forms and the application of interviews, configuring itself as a case study. The subjects of the research were professors of the P.E. course at the Federal University of Sergipe. The analysis of two data forms was constituted through the application of the content analysis technique. The results show that teachers have heterogeneous training perspectives in the context of digital culture. In this context, formative contributions are evident, such as the establishment of a critical perspective in the teaching-learning process, both in the school and academic setting, for the field of physical education. This enables the development of diverse themes, such as sports and its relationship with cinema and media in general.
